Node 第三方中介軟體

2021-09-28 11:11:15 字數 1527 閱讀 1614

有關第三方中介軟體,這裡我們分析幾個比較重要和常用的,知道這幾個的使用,其它的也就會了。

body-parser :解析body中的資料,並將其儲存為request物件的body屬性。

cookie-parser :解析客戶端cookie中的資料,並將其儲存為request物件的cookie屬性

express-session :解析服務端生成的sessionid對應的session資料,並將其儲存為request物件的session屬性

query:這個中介軟體將乙個查詢字串從url轉換為js物件,並將其儲存為request物件的query屬性。這個中介軟體在第四個版本中已經內建了無需安裝。

目錄

使用body-parser外掛程式解析post請求的表單資料

使用body-parser外掛程式解析ajax請求的json資料

2.login.html 

npm install body-parser
const express = require('express');

const bodyparser = require('body-parser')

// 掛載內建中介軟體

// 掛載引數處理中介軟體(post)

// 處理get提交引數

let data = req.query;

console.log(data);

res.send('get data');

});// 處理post提交引數

let data = req.body;

// console.log(data);

if(data.username == 'admin' && data.password == '123')else

}); console.log('running...');

});

const express = require('express');

const bodyparser = require('body-parser')

// 掛載內建中介軟體

// 掛載引數處理中介軟體(post)

// 處理get提交引數

let data = req.query;

console.log(data);

res.send('get data');

});// 處理post提交引數

let data = req.body;

// console.log(data);

if(data.username == 'admin' && data.password == '123')else

}); res.end('put data');

}); res.end('delete data');

}); console.log('running...');

});

Koa教程筆記(二) 第三方中介軟體 ejs

需要安裝的包 koa,koa router,koa views和ejs。第三方中介軟體 配置模板引擎中介軟體 第三方中介軟體 第乙個引數是模板存放位置 use views views 公共資料共享 use async ctx,next ejs模板呼叫 呼叫方式與nodejs中呼叫的引數基本一致,不過...

node常用外掛程式 第三方模組 中介軟體使用

用於熱更新,隨時監控檔案的變化 安裝npm i g nodemon 使用nodemon index.js nvm用於nodejs版本管理,我們在開發過程中,不同的專案需要使用不同的node版本,這時我們可以使用nvm來切換當前使用版本 mac下配置 在終端中執行curl o bash 或wget q...

Node 第三方模組

什麼是第三方模組?別人寫好的 具有特定功能的 我們能直接使用的模組即第三方模組,由於第三方模組通常都是由多個檔案組成硬切被放置在乙個資料夾中,所以又名包。第三方模組有兩種存在形式 以js檔案的形式存在,通常封裝了一些特定的功能,並向外提供實現專案具體功能的api介面,讓其他的開發者呼叫。以命令列工具...